A bundle of communication wires fell from the elevated subway tracks above a Cypress Hill avenue on Friday, damaging six vehicles under however leaving subway service on the J prepare unscathed.

The falling thick wires broken six vehicles on the road under, however no accidents had been reported.

A bundle of communication wires that fell from the elevated subway tracks above Fulton St. between Linwood St. and Elton St. in Cypress Hill, Brooklyn, broken six vehicles on Friday, Jan. 30, 2026. (Theodore Parisienne / New York Each day Information)

The cable remained intact and practical because it drooped right down to avenue degree, sources mentioned, permitting communications and signaling on the road to proceed.
